The Church of Dimitri Donskoy at the 1st Cadet Corps

The Dimitry Donskoy Chapel Church attached to the 1st Cadet Corps was built in 2001. It was built by the Alpha group in memory of the fallen soldiers of the Pskov Division during the fighting in Chechnya. In terms of the building type, it is a wooden, chopped structure on a stone base, with one head, on a round drum, with a double-pitched thatched roof and with an elegant porch on the west side. There is a belfry on wooden pillars next to the church. The church was consecrated in 2001 by His Holiness Patriarch Alexy II of Moscow and All Russia.
